Launching a Sportsbook

sportsbook

A sportsbook is a place where people can make wagers on different sporting events. Those who bet on the winning team will receive a payout in accordance with the odds and spreads that are offered. This type of gambling establishment is typically found in casinos and other large venues that offer high-quality viewing experiences, lounge seating, and multiple food and drink options. There are also online versions of these gambling sites that allow players to bet from the comfort of their homes.

One of the most important things to consider when creating a sportsbook is how to attract users and keep them engaged. This is accomplished by offering a variety of betting markets, odds, and promotions. In addition, users should be able to access their betting history and track the status of their bets. A good sportsbook will also provide a range of payment methods for easy deposits and withdrawals.

While launching a sportsbook is not an easy task, it can be done successfully with the right planning and execution. There are several steps that should be taken into account, including law regulations, data and odds providers, payment gateways, KYC verification suppliers, risk management systems, and so on. It is also important to include a reward system in your product so that your users will be motivated to continue using it.

A good sportsbook will have a large menu of options for different teams, leagues, and events. It should also offer fair odds and a decent return on bets placed on these different types of markets. It is also important to provide live betting options so that players can bet on events as they happen. This will add a whole new level of excitement to the game and will keep players coming back for more.

There are many different ways to launch a sportsbook, but the best way is to develop a custom solution from scratch. This will ensure that the final product fits all of your needs and requirements. It will also save you time and money since it will not require you to look for workaround solutions.

Another benefit of developing a custom sportsbook is that it will be easier to integrate with existing systems. For example, it will be possible to integrate the sportsbook with data and odds providers, as well as payment systems and KYC verification providers. Moreover, the custom solution will be fully responsive and compatible with mobile devices.
